Hepimiz internette gezinirken bir sayfanın ne kadar hızlı yüklendiğine dikkat ederiz. Eğer sayfa uzun süre yükleniyorsa, çoğu zaman sabırsızlanıp hemen başka bir siteye geçeriz. Peki, web sitenizin hızını artırmanın yollarını biliyor musunuz? Web sitesi hızı, kullanıcı deneyiminizi doğrudan etkilerken, SEO performansınızı da büyük ölçüde iyileştirebilir. Yavaş yüklenen bir site, sadece ziyaretçi kaybına yol açmakla kalmaz, aynı zamanda Google gibi arama motorları tarafından olumsuz değerlendirilir.
Bu yazıda, web sitenizin hızını artırmak için uygulayabileceğiniz 10 pratik öneriyi paylaşacağım. Hazırsanız başlayalım!
1. Görsellerinizi Sıkıştırın
Web sitenizin hızını artırmak için ilk yapmanız gereken şeylerden biri, görsellerin boyutunu küçültmektir. Büyük boyutlu görseller, sayfa yükleme hızını ciddi şekilde yavaşlatabilir. Ancak görsel kalitesinden ödün vermeden boyutlarını küçültmek mümkündür.
2. Tarayıcı Önbellekleme Kullanın
Bir kullanıcı siteyi ilk kez ziyaret ettiğinde, tarayıcı bazı verileri kaydeder. Bu, sonraki ziyaretlerde sayfanın daha hızlı yüklenmesini sağlar. Tarayıcı önbellekleme, sitenizdeki statik dosyaların (CSS, JavaScript, resimler vb.) bilgisini kullanıcıların cihazlarında tutar. Bu sayede, her seferinde bu dosyaların yeniden yüklenmesine gerek kalmaz.
# Tarayıcı önbellek ayarları
Header set Cache-Control "max-age=2592000, public"
3. İçerik Dağıtım Ağı (CDN) Kullanın
Bir CDN (Content Delivery Network), web sitenizin statik içeriklerini farklı sunucularda saklayarak, ziyaretçilerin fiziksel olarak en yakın sunucudan bu içeriği almasını sağlar. Bu, sayfa yükleme hızını ciddi şekilde iyileştirebilir, özellikle global ziyaretçileriniz varsa.
4. CSS ve JavaScript Dosyalarını Minifikasyonu
Web sitenizdeki CSS ve JavaScript dosyaları genellikle gereksiz boşluklar, satır sonları ve yorumlarla doludur. Bu dosyaların minifikasyonu, bu gereksiz öğeleri kaldırarak dosya boyutunu küçültür ve sayfa yükleme hızını artırır.
# CSS ve JS minifikasyonu
5. Sunucu Yanıt Süresini İyileştirin
Web sitenizin sunucusunun yanıt süresi, sayfa yükleme hızını doğrudan etkiler. Eğer sunucunuzun yanıt süresi çok uzunsa, sayfa yükleme süresi de buna bağlı olarak artar. Bu durumu iyileştirmek için daha hızlı bir hosting sağlayıcısına geçmeyi veya mevcut sunucunuzun yapılandırmalarını optimize etmeyi düşünebilirsiniz.
Google, mobil uyumlu siteleri tercih eder ve mobil uyumluluk, kullanıcı deneyimini büyük ölçüde etkiler. Mobil uyumlu bir site, özellikle akıllı telefon kullanıcıları için oldukça önemlidir. Eğer siteniz mobil uyumlu değilse, hız optimizasyonu da dahil olmak üzere bir dizi soruna yol açabilirsiniz.
Responsive tasarımlar kullanarak, sitenizin her cihazda mükemmel göründüğünden emin olun.
7. HTTP İsteklerini Azaltın
Web sayfanızda her öğe (görseller, stil dosyaları, fontlar vb.) için bir HTTP isteği yapılır. Bu istekler arttıkça, sayfanın yüklenme süresi de uzar. Sayfanızdaki HTTP isteklerini azaltmak için öğeleri birleştirme ya da dosyaları önceden yükleme gibi teknikler kullanabilirsiniz.
Lazy loading, sadece görünür olan içeriklerin yüklenmesini sağlayarak sayfa yükleme süresini hızlandırır. Bu özellik özellikle görseller ve videolar için oldukça etkilidir. Görsel ya da video yalnızca kullanıcı tarafından görünür olduğunda yüklenir, böylece gereksiz veri transferinden kaçınılmış olur.
# Lazy loading örneği
9. Ziyaretçi Sayısını Azaltın
Sayfanızda çok fazla ziyaretçi varsa, bu da yükleme süresini uzatabilir. Sunucunuzun kapasitesini artırarak ya da gereksiz ziyaretçileri engelleyerek bu durumu iyileştirebilirsiniz.
Web sitenizde kullandığınız tema, hız üzerinde büyük bir etkiye sahiptir. Yavaş çalışan bir tema, tüm siteyi yavaşlatabilir. Bu yüzden, hızlı yüklenen ve güncel temalar seçmek oldukça önemlidir.